scripts/coccinelle/misc/semicolon.cocci: Use imperative mood
According to Documentation/SubmittingPatches:
"Describe your changes in imperative mood, e.g. "make xyzzy do frotz"
instead of "[This patch] makes xyzzy do frotz" or "[I] changed xyzzy
to do frotz", as if you are giving orders to the codebase to change
its behaviour.
So do as recommended.
